The nominations were announced on January 22, 2008, at the Samuel Goldwyn Theater in Beverly Hills, California by Sid Ganis, president of the Academy, and actress Kathy Bates. [11] . No Country for Old Men and There Will Be Blood tied for the most nominations with eight each. [12] .

    • 2023: Brendan Fraser, The Whale. Following a decades-long break from the industry, Oscar winner Fraser made a triumphant return in The Whale, which follows the story of a reclusive man trying to repair his relationship with his teen daughter.
    • 2022: Will Smith, King Richard. Smith won his first Oscar in 2022 for his performance as Richard Williams — Venus and Serena's father — in King Richard.
    • 2021: Anthony Hopkins, The Father. Hopkins became the oldest star to win the Best Actor title when he was awarded the prize for his performance in The Father at age 83.
    • 2020: Joaquin Phoenix, Joker. Phoenix won the award for his role as the titular villain. The actor is currently filming the movie's sequel, Joker: Folie à Deux.
